Ketamine goes by many names. Its official names include ketalar and ketaset. However, it also has various street names including "Lady K," "Special K" "Vitamin K" "Cat Valium" and "Kit-Kat." No matter what you call it, Ketamine could be a very harmful drug.
Not just does it cause memory loss and brain damage when used on a long-term basis, the drug also can cause injury to the urinary tract. In reality, it can irreversibly harm the user's kidneys and liver as well. Since Ketamine is a party drug, many abusers of this drug don't realize exactly how dangerous it happens to be.
As more long-term studies of Ketamine surface, it's clear that the drug can be truly harmful. In reality, many long-term users end up suffering from poor bladder control. Some users find yourself having to attend the restroom every 15 minutes. A Reuter's article noted the results of a study of Ketamine users in Hong Kong. The study indicated that 60% of drug abusers experienced depression, 31% reported that these were struggling to concentrate, and 23% noted serious memory issues.
